Named after its ability to cleverly adapt to its environment, Chameleon is an agile table that takes commercial configuration to new levels. Its range of features are a product of extensive engineering, offering limitless dimensional, typological and aesthetic table solutions with a singular design language. Seamless, the Chameleon is refined in its engineering, functional in design and versatile in form, ready to adapt to the dynamic world for which it was designed.

Also designed by Tom Fereday, was the King Living stand at Denfair itself- the largest display King has presented to date. Providing a sanctuary for calm through the use of raised platforms, the stand created a feeling of immersiveness and independence from the rest of the fair. Each of the four themes represented invited guests into an intimate homely, space. “My favourite feature of the stand is that it can be viewed from the outside through a series of vignettes, or from inside by walking through and directly interacting with the products,” says Fereday.

Made up from over twenty made-to-order designs, each rug is constructed using complex visual compositions which highlight the quality and skill of traditional weaving techniques and the depth of history instilled into each piece. The collection is richly evocative of central Africa and crafted by hand using lustrous wool, we also loved the colour palette of earthy and indigo tones which reflect the collection’s African design narrative.
